The 25th AARP Movies for Grownups Awards, presented by AARP: The Magazine, honored films and television series released in 2025.[1][2][3] The nominations were announced on November 19, 2025, with the action thriller One Battle After Another leading the nominations with eight, followed by the historical drama Nuremberg with four.[1][4][5]

Created by and about people over the age of 50, the winners were announced on January 10, 2026.[3] The ceremony took place at the Beverly Wilshire Hotel in Los Angeles and was hosted by Alan Cumming.[3][6][7] The event was broadcast by Great Performances on PBS on February 22, 2026.[1][8][9]

Adam Sandler received the Career Achievement Award.[10]
